The Challenges, Chemistry, Materials
and Future Perspectives
Lithium-sulfur (Li-S) batteries give us an alternative to the more prevalent
lithium-ion (Li-ion) versions, and are known for their observed high energy
densities. Systems using Li-S batteries are in early stages of development and
commercialization however could potentially provide higher, safer levels of energy
at significantly lower cost.
In this book the history, scientific background, challenges and future perspectives
of the lithium-sulfur system are presented by experts in the field. Focus is on past
and recent advances of each cell compartment responsible for the performance
of the Li-S battery, and includes analysis of characterization tools, new designs
and computational modeling. As a comprehensive review of current state-of-
play, it is ideal for undergraduates, graduate students, researchers, physicists,
chemists and materials scientists interested in energy storage, material science
and electrochemistry.
